The room was clean and the beds were very comfy. We ate in the bar area and had a "football special' sharing platter which was very tasty and not bad value. Drinks were not badly priced especially if you knew you were having a 2nd pint as it worked out a lot cheaper if you paid for 2 pints on your first visit to the bar. You were given a token to get your 2nd pint. We had a quad room (4 single beds) with our 2 grand kids and there was plenty of space. The price was exceptional value as booked through Booking.com and I am a Genius member so got great discounts. Dont be put off by where the hotel is as it is part of a working office block. Once you get to the reception area you will notice the difference in decor. A tip for future guests. When using the lifts...select the floor above where you need and then walk down the few steps as the floors are 'split' level.

Cons:

Although the bathroom was very clean indeed and one half had been fully modernised, the actual bath looked tired around the edges but for a one night stay it was fine. Plenty of hot water. The price of the breakfast if you haven't booked (£13.95?)and we couldn’t see a kids breakfast option but we only looked at the advertising poster.
